BIOGRAPHY

Roger Dallier, a notable figure in French cinema, carved his niche as a director with a unique vision, particularly evident in his 1949 film "Mademoiselle de la Ferté." This film, a captivating blend of drama and romance set against the backdrop of post-war France, showcases Dallier's ability to weave intricate narratives that resonate with audiences and collectors alike. "Mademoiselle de la Ferté" is especially sought after for its rich cinematography and strong performances, often considered a gem in the canon of French films from the late 1940s.
